分数计数器是一个用于记录和计算分数的工具。它可以在代码中被使用,以便在特定的情况下对分数进行增加、减少或重置操作。
分数计数器的实现可以基于各种编程语言和技术。以下是一个示例的分数计数器的代码片段:
class ScoreCounter:
def __init__(self):
self.score = 0
def increase_score(self, points):
self.score += points
def decrease_score(self, points):
self.score -= points
def reset_score(self):
self.score = 0
在上述代码中,我们定义了一个名为ScoreCounter
的类,它具有以下功能:
__init__
方法用于初始化计数器,将分数初始化为0。increase_score
方法用于增加分数,接受一个参数points
表示要增加的分数。decrease_score
方法用于减少分数,接受一个参数points
表示要减少的分数。reset_score
方法用于重置分数,将分数设置为0。这个分数计数器可以在各种应用场景中使用,例如游戏开发、竞赛评分、学生考试等。它可以帮助开发人员方便地跟踪和管理分数。
对于腾讯云相关产品,推荐使用云函数(Serverless Cloud Function)来实现分数计数器的功能。云函数是一种无需管理服务器即可运行代码的计算服务,可以根据实际需求弹性地分配计算资源。您可以使用腾讯云云函数(SCF)来编写和部署上述分数计数器的代码。
腾讯云云函数(SCF)是腾讯云提供的一种事件驱动的无服务器计算服务,支持多种编程语言(如Python、Node.js、Java等),具有高可用性、弹性伸缩、按量计费等特点。您可以通过以下链接了解更多关于腾讯云云函数的信息:
通过使用腾讯云云函数,您可以轻松地将分数计数器的功能部署到云端,并根据实际需求进行灵活的调整和扩展。
领取专属 10元无门槛券
手把手带您无忧上云